6 FAQs about Solar Microgrid Energy Storage Business Model
What is a microgrid business model?
With respect to microgrids, a business model defines the way in which a microgrid project or business is planned, implemented, and executed to meet strategic objectives. Strategic objectives can range from community resiliency to renewable energy integration to greater profit for a new economy enterprise such as a data center.
How will the microgrid energy storage business model evolve?
The rapid increase in user-side energy storage such as new energy vehicles, power battery cascade utilization and household photovoltaics will also lead to the rapid development of the microgrid energy storage business model. The microgrid model originating from the user side will drive the establishment of the energy storage market mechanism.
What is a microgrid & how does it work?
The core of the electricity market is competition. Microgrid operators can make full use of distributed energy resources to provide differentiated power services to expand their business, such as combined cooling, heating and power; integrated energy service management and other diversified means.
What drives microgrid development?
Resilience, efficiency, sustainability, flexibility, security, and reliability are key drivers for microgrid developments. These factors motivate the need for integrated models and tools for microgrid planning, design, and operations at higher and higher levels of complexity.
How can renewable micro-grids be expanded?
However, to achieve this expansion of renewable micro-grids, the International Renewable Energy Agency (IRENA) argue that replicable business models which can attract finance (IRENA, 2019b), leverage local supply chains and empower communities to maintain and benefit from these systems (IRENA & SELCO, 2022), are now needed.
Can a microgrid be commercially & financially viable?
For a microgrid to be commercially and financially viable, it must address both the technical (e.g., plan, operations, components, and functions) and commercial (e.g., revenue, expense, and profit) components of the business model definition.
